Transaction 27a2f9465b4c729601ca08e51f4a14c46ed57827b009b55a11e429ebbf6f16e5

2 Input
2 Outputs
  • 27a2f9465b4c729601ca08e51f4a14c46ed57827b009b55a11e429ebbf6f16e5:0
  • value  470964282
    address  3EhVRvDQSpZ3Sf6kRmePwwecTKq452odyC
  • 27a2f9465b4c729601ca08e51f4a14c46ed57827b009b55a11e429ebbf6f16e5:1
  • value  16296199
    address  3BMEXT8ig5id4Gphuj7G6sYWDsXPBmpYyf